    Anticipated start date of June 20th, 2024.

    Responsible for the organization and execution of all Aquatic Programming at William G. White, Jr Family YMCA including Swim Lessons, Lifeguards and Water Fitness. This position supervises all aquatics staff and programs at the branch. The successful candidate will implement the full spectrum of aquatic programming for members of all ages and abilities, growing the passion and capabilities of our community in the water so that they can take their knowledge to the next level and become life-long swimmers. If you thrive on helping others and have a passion for Youth Development, Healthy Living and Social Responsibility, then join our cause.

    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

    Promotes and incorporates the YMCA five core values and character development model into all program activities.
    • Develop and manage a yearly budget for all related departments to meet fiscal objectives.
    • Provide direct supervision to all aquatic staff.
    • Recruit, train, and develop program staff and volunteers in aquatics.
    • Assist in the marketing and distribution of program information.
    • Organize and schedule program registrations.
    • Be willing to work evenings and weekends as needed.
    •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ness and participation in programs.
    • Develop and maintain collaborative relationships with other community organizations.
    • Coordinate use of aquatic facilities for members, program activities and events.
    • Establish new program activities and expand programs within the community in accordance with the Association and branch strategic plans.
    • Assist in branch fund raising activities and special events.
    • Respond to all member and community inquiries and complaints in a timely manner.
    • Identify staffing and training needs, hire, train, coach and evaluate staff.
    • Provide Swim Instructor and Water Fitness instructor in-service training for programming, customer service, and safety procedures on a quarterly schedule.
    • Provide Lifeguard in-service training for lifesaving skills, customer service, and safety procedures on a monthly schedule.
    • Review and maintain payroll for department staff.
    • Work with the Director and Human Resources to handle employee relations and discipline, with documentation, involving aquatics staff and patrons.
    • Work with leadership and the Marketing Department to develop marketing strategy and campaign material for Aquatics (including articles, brochures, postcards, program guide entries, audience identification, etc).
    • Continuously seek program/program adjustments to meet the needs of the community such as Home School Swim Lessons, Special Needs Lessons, Second Grade Swim, etc.
    • Utilize excellent customer service skills, establish and maintain effective working relationships with employees, members, vendors, and the community including answering calls promptly.
    • Organize and/or conduct YMCA Lifeguard and ASHI courses for internal and external customers.
    • Work with Aquatic staff to help ensure they are up to date on all required certifications, at all times and take lead on all LRT trainings.
    • Be available to fill in as a lifeguard or swim instructor as needed.
    • Work with aquatic and branch staff to organize the monthly lifeguard and pool schedules and make them available each month by the last week of the previous month.
    • Provide leadership and direction in the development and implementation of short and long range strategic plans.
    • Follow the quality standards of the Aquatic Department as specified by the Aquatic AOC.
    • Function as Risk Manager for the branch, organize leadership roles, branch strategies and training on the branch EAP and ensure that all departments incorporate safety training into their in-services.
    • Assist in the development and execution fundraising events for the Aquatics Department such as United Way and Annual Impact Fund.

    S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ES

    Directly supervises part time and non-exempt employees and volunteers.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ization's polic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include interviewing, hiring, and training employees; planning, assigning, and directing work; reviewing and approving timesheets;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; monitoring and updating all required staff certifications; addressing complaints and resolving problems.

    C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, TRAININGS must be completed within first year of employment.

    All staff are required to complete: Child Abuse Prevention for Supervisory Staff; Working with Program Volunteers; Bloodborne Pathogens; Child Abuse Prevention and Reporting Awareness

    Lifeguard/Pool Operation: CPO, CPR/AED, First Aid, Oxygen, YMCA Lifeguard, ASHI/YMCA Lifeguard Instructor

    Swim Lesson: YSL V6 Instructor
